How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Midtown?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Midtown Studio Apartments | $958 | $725 | $1,537 |
Midtown 1 Bedroom Apartments | $998 | $505 | $1,920 |
Midtown 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,243 | $570 | $3,800 |
Midtown 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,551 | $850 | $2,342 |
Midtown 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,697 | $1,295 | $2,100 |
